    GIBS Business School, Bangalore accepts scores from several national and state-level entrance exams for admission to its MBA/PGDM programs. The primary exams accepted are:

    ProgramAccepted Entrance Exams
    PGDM / MBACAT, XAT, MAT, CMAT, ATMA, GMAT, KMAT, State CETs
    BBANot required (Class 12 marks considered)

    Note: Meeting the minimum qualifying marks in both the entrance exam and academics is required for shortlisting. The final selection is based on a combination of entrance test score, academic record, interview/GD performance, and other profile components.

    GIBS Business School, Bangalore accepts scores from several national and state-level entrance exams for admission to its PGDM program. These include CAT, MAT, XAT, CMAT, ATMA, GMAT, and state-level exams like Karnataka CET. For the BBA program, an entrance exam is not mandatory. Admissions are mainly based on your Class 12 marks, a Statement of Purpose (SOP), and performance in a personal interview. GIBS focuses on the overall personality and potential of the student, so even if you don't have an entrance exam score for BBA, you still have a good chance if you perform well in the selection process.

There is an application or registration fee for submitting an application to GIBS Business School that cannot be refunded, and varies depending on the programme you select to apply for. The approximate application fee amounts for the academic year comprising 2025 - 2026, are:

PGDM and MBA programmes - approximately ₹850 to ₹950 (for online and offline successful applicants).

BBA Programme - approximately ₹600 to ₹750 (for online and offline successful applicants).
